The Berliner Abgeordnetenhaus is the state parliament of Berlin, Germany. It is responsible for enacting laws, electing the Governing Mayor, and overseeing the Berlin Senate. Recent news focuses on the upcoming elections in September, with polls indicating a lead for the CDU and a decline in SPD support, particularly in East Berlin. This suggests a potential shift in the political landscape of the city. Additionally, the Abgeordnetenhaus, specifically the Jugendhilfeausschuss (youth welfare committee) of the Bezirksverordnetenversammlung (district assembly) of Berlin-Neukölln, is addressing allegations against youth services employees. The committee is investigating why staff at a youth center allegedly failed to report a suspected rape of a minor, highlighting concerns about child protection and the accountability of youth welfare services.
